Who should be re-signed?
We have a huge list of players set to be UFA after this season. I know it’s only the halfway point, but it’s not too early to start the conversation.
We’re slated to have 24m in estimated cap space according to overthecap and currently have around 23m to rollover from this season. So, unless I’m way off (which is possible, I’m just adding up our current cap space and next years estimated taken from OTC), will have close to 47m in space before doing anything with Sammy Watkins. If we choose to cut Watkins, that adds another 14m in cap space. Chad Henne Xavier Williams Lesean McCoy Darron Lee Jordan Lucas Morris Claiborne Bashaud Breeland Emmanuel Ogbah Chris Jones Reggie Ragland Matt Moore Kendall Fuller Anthony Sherman Stefan Wisnewski So far, Ogbah, Jones, Breeland and Ragland have probably all earned reasonable FA deals unless Veach thinks upgrades can be had at similar cost. |
